Johannesburg – The National Student Financial Aid Scheme (NSFAS) has condemned and slammed a “disturbing” advertising stunt by an establishment, Europa Lounge, in Pretoria, Gauteng.
The establishment was offering discounted prices on alcoholic beverages to students, using the tagline “NSFAS INGENILE” meaning “money has is in”.
“This reckless behaviour not only perpetuates undue use of the NSFAS allowance by its beneficiaries… it also counters the efforts by the scheme to instil financial responsibility to its beneficiaries,” it said.
